Transaction 82609a8fd09f8e2fc899bb979761885f094c5bb3430c67eb2e14a3428c5e6db8
1 Input
1 Output
-
82609a8fd09f8e2fc899bb979761885f094c5bb3430c67eb2e14a3428c5e6db8:0
- value
- 3881436
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5fb4b5200c57d1b5efbf1727d18d4ce21fa10a93 OP_EQUAL
- address
- 3AR4bYduNfZjpCSusFqyGqyHTMVE2R2qmy